What’s the Big Deal About the Pulmonary Artery?

So, what exactly does the pulmonary artery do? This tube-like structure has one primary responsibility: it carries venous (or oxygen-poor) blood from the heart to the lungs. That's right! While you probably picture arteries as channels for oxygen-rich blood, the pulmonary artery flips this narrative on its head. By transporting deoxygenated blood away from the heart's right ventricle to the lungs, it sets the stage for one of the most crucial processes your body undergoes—gas exchange.

When the right ventricle contracts, it sends this oxygen-poor blood through the pulmonary artery. Follow along; it’s like sending a package straight to the post office—but instead of letters, we’re talking about life-giving oxygen! Once the blood reaches the lungs, it enters a network of tiny blood vessels called capillaries. Here’s where the magic happens: as blood flows past the alveoli (tiny air sacs in the lungs), carbon dioxide is released, and oxygen is absorbed. It’s like your blood is getting a fresh breath of life!

A Quick Note on the Heart and Lungs Connection

Speaking of interconnections, let’s not forget the larger picture here. The pulmonary artery is part of a team. Inside our hearts, the left side pumps oxygen-rich blood to the rest of the body through the aorta, while the right side, through the pulmonary artery, sends deoxygenated blood to the lungs. Now, isn’t that a neat orchestration? Each vessel has its role, harmonizing together like an orchestra playing the same beautiful symphony with different sections.

And what about the pulmonary veins, you ask? Just as the pulmonary artery carries blood to the lungs, the pulmonary veins return freshly oxygenated blood back to the heart. It's like a continuous loop, ensuring your body gets the oxygen it craves and removing carbon dioxide. This isn't just fascinating biology; it’s a testament to the complexity of life itself.

The Bigger Picture: Health Implications

Let's sidestep for a moment and consider health implications. Issues with the pulmonary artery can lead to a variety of health problems, including pulmonary hypertension, wherein the pressure within the artery becomes abnormally high. This can ultimately impact how well your body oxygenates blood. Recognizing the symptoms—like shortness of breath or fatigue—can empower you to seek help sooner rather than later.
